Re: Is there a way to average a particular Decay Time and generate filters on that


You can just load a house curve to move the target up at the low end so REW offers less cut down there. Ignore the filter recommendations between 100 and 200Hz for the moment, just apply the largest filters at 48 and 43 and see how that is.

If you want to see what the response looks like after 160ms or so and work out some filters based on that, just use the IR Windows dialogue to move the window ref time to 160ms and reapply the windows. The difficulty with setting up filters for the later part of the response is knowing what the correct reference level is, so you'll have to tweak the target level by hand until it looks right before asking REW to work out some filters.
